Hours: Monday through Friday 7:30am to 4pm April through September Monday through Friday WebMonmouth is about 15 miles (24 km) west of Salem on Oregon Route 99W. It lies in the Ash Creek watershed, slightly west of the Willamette River . According to the United States Census Bureau , the city has a total area of 2.24 square miles (5.80 km 2 ), all of it land.
